Объект для расчета сальдовых остатков и учетом МТР

Контур оперативного управления

Модератор: ZYG

Ответить
Аватара пользователя
dixgrey
топ-софт
Сообщения: 15
Зарегистрирован: Пт, 19/10/2007 14:54
Имя Фамилия: Дмитрий Понин
Откуда: ТопСофт
Контактная информация:

Объект для расчета сальдовых остатков и учетом МТР

Сообщение dixgrey »

L\L_SALDOMTR\vip\MTRFuncs\SaldoFuncs.vip

Добавил функцию для быстрого и удобного заполнения таблицы TmpSaldo1 остатками с учетом МТР и различных типов остатков: склад, УКС, УПЛ, ремонты.

Особенности
- В отличие от store_run, данный объект учитывает ЦУ.
- Для учета остатков в различных разрезах достаточно запустить его 1 раз.
- В отличие от oStore.UksStore_Run, данный объект учитывает остатки без ЦУ.

Function Store_run_new(datecalc :date; // дата рассчета
bSkl // складские остатки SP=0
, bUPL // УПЛ остатки SP=1
, bRem // ремонтные остатки SP=2
, bUks // УКС остатки SP=3
: boolean;
coMc // фильтр по МЦ
, coPodr // фильтр по складу
, coMol // фильтр по МОЛ
, coParty // фильтр по партии
: comp;
bNeedMTR // выгружать остатки по МТР
: boolean;
cTune // фильтр по ЦУ
, cObj // фильтр по объекту
: comp;
bNGrPodr // группировать по складам
, bNGrMOL // группировать по МОЛ
, bNGrParty // группировать по Партиям
: boolean ) : boolean;

Фильтры устанавливаются аналогично объекту store_run
(0 - нет фильтра, -1 - фильтр по остаткам с незаданным разрезом, -2 - фильтр по нескольким разрезам - берется из таблицы Pick)
Аватара пользователя
Evchic
партнер
Сообщения: 88
Зарегистрирован: Пн, 17/09/2007 07:57
Имя Фамилия: Евгений Ильин
Откуда: Галактика ЮГ г.Ростов-на-Дону
Контактная информация:

Сообщение Evchic »

эта функция в каких обновления? или еще не доступна?
Аватара пользователя
dixgrey
топ-софт
Сообщения: 15
Зарегистрирован: Пт, 19/10/2007 14:54
Имя Фамилия: Дмитрий Понин
Откуда: ТопСофт
Контактная информация:

Сообщение dixgrey »

пока нет, выйдет в ближайших, я напишу как она появится в патчах
Аватара пользователя
Evchic
партнер
Сообщения: 88
Зарегистрирован: Пн, 17/09/2007 07:57
Имя Фамилия: Евгений Ильин
Откуда: Галактика ЮГ г.Ростов-на-Дону
Контактная информация:

Сообщение Evchic »

А нельзя отдельным debug получить данную функцию! для теста!!!
Аватара пользователя
dixgrey
топ-софт
Сообщения: 15
Зарегистрирован: Пт, 19/10/2007 14:54
Имя Фамилия: Дмитрий Понин
Откуда: ТопСофт
Контактная информация:

Сообщение dixgrey »

пока болею дома, тока после вторника что-нить могу придумать :)
Аватара пользователя
Evchic
партнер
Сообщения: 88
Зарегистрирован: Пн, 17/09/2007 07:57
Имя Фамилия: Евгений Ильин
Откуда: Галактика ЮГ г.Ростов-на-Дону
Контактная информация:

Сообщение Evchic »

было бы хорошо очень большая заинтересованность в данном функционале!
Аватара пользователя
dixgrey
топ-софт
Сообщения: 15
Зарегистрирован: Пт, 19/10/2007 14:54
Имя Фамилия: Дмитрий Понин
Откуда: ТопСофт
Контактная информация:

Сообщение dixgrey »

объект выйдет в обновлении L_SALDOMTR_RES_810290

надо будет подключть
#include SaldoFuncs.vih
и
#include SaldoFuncs.var

oSaldoFun.Store_run_new(...);
Ответить